What is an Epic Beaker Analyst?

An Epic Beaker Analyst is a healthcare IT professional responsible for implementing, configuring, and maintaining the Epic Beaker laboratory information system (LIS). They work with clinical and technical teams to optimize workflows, ensure system integrity, and support compliance with regulatory standards. Their duties include troubleshooting issues, building and testing system configurations, and training end users. Strong analytical skills and Epic Beaker certification are typically required for this role.

What does an Epic Beaker Analyst do?

A typical day for an Epic Beaker Analyst involves analyzing workflow requirements, building and maintaining Epic Beaker modules, troubleshooting system issues, and collaborating with laboratory personnel to optimize system usage. You may participate in project meetings, conduct end-user training, and support ongoing upgrades or system enhancements. The role also often includes creating reports, validating results, and responding to support tickets to ensure laboratory operations run smoothly. Analysts regularly work with both IT and clinical teams, making strong communication and multitasking abilities especially valuable. This dynamic environment offers the chance to make a direct impact on laboratory efficiency and patient outcomes.

What skills and qualifications are needed to be an Epic Beaker Analyst?

To thrive as an Epic Beaker Analyst, you need a strong background in clinical laboratory science, healthcare IT, and data analysis, often supported by a degree in a science or information technology field and experience with laboratory workflows. Expertise with the Epic Beaker Laboratory Information System (LIS), including Epic Beaker certification, as well as familiarity with interface tools and reporting solutions, is typically required. Strong analytical thinking, attention to detail, problem-solving abilities, and effective communication skills are essential for collaborating with technical teams and laboratory staff. These competencies are crucial for ensuring optimal system performance, streamlining lab processes, and supporting high-quality patient care.

How to get hired as an Epic Beaker analyst?

To get hired as an Epic Beaker analyst, candidates typically need a background in laboratory information systems, healthcare IT, or related fields, along with experience working with Epic Beaker software. Earning Epic certifications and demonstrating proficiency in clinical laboratory workflows can improve job prospects, and employers often seek candidates with strong analytical and technical skills. Familiarity with healthcare regulations and the ability to work in a fast-paced environment are also beneficial.

Job Title: Lab Assistant IIIJob Description

This Lab Assistant III role supports a high-volume, production-based clinical laboratory by performing essential specimen processing and data entry tasks that directly contribute to accurate and timely patient testing. The position operates Monday through Friday from 8:00 a.m. to 5:00 p.m. and focuses on receiving, preparing, and organizing clinical specimens while maintaining strict safety and quality standards.

Responsibilities
  • Receive and sort clinical laboratory specimens in a high-volume, production-based environment.
  • Prepare specimens for testing and analysis according to established laboratory protocols.
  • Scan and enter specimen and patient information accurately into the laboratory information systems.
  • Verify that all required information accompanies each specimen and resolve discrepancies as needed.
  • Ensure all laboratory equipment is functioning properly and perform minor instrumentation maintenance.
  • Troubleshoot specimen-related issues, including labeling, integrity, and processing concerns.
  • Replenish test bench supplies and maintain appropriate inventory levels to support continuous workflow.
  • Maintain a clean, organized, and safe work area in accordance with laboratory safety guidelines.
  • Complete record logs and other administrative documentation accurately and in a timely manner.
  • Follow all Standard Operating Procedures to maintain safety, quality, and regulatory compliance.
  • Handle biological specimens safely and in accordance with established handling and disposal procedures.
  • Prioritize and multitask to meet established turnaround times in a fast-paced environment.
  • Communicate clearly with colleagues and other stakeholders to support smooth laboratory operations.
  • Sit and/or stand for extended periods while performing repetitive laboratory tasks.
  • Work overtime as needed to support operational demands and ensure timely completion of testing.
